Scam Alert from the Solicitors Regulation Authority website:
A document headed "Debt Acknowledgment Form (IOU)" has been drafted with a letterhead of "Gareth Taylor Solicitors".

The document seen by the SRA states that "Andrew Drayton" of "Gareth Taylor Solicitors" was acting as a guarantor for the debt.

The SRA does not authorise or regulate a genuine firm called "Gareth Taylor Solicitors" or any genuine solicitors named "Andrew Drayton" (or named "Gareth Taylor").

The document contains an address for "Gareth Taylor Solicitors" of "105 Fleming Close, London, SW10 0AH, United Kingdom", email addresses of "office@garethtaylorsolicitor.co.uk" and "andrew.drayton@garethtaylorsolicitors.co.uk", the telephone number "+44 844 357 0048" and a website link of "www.garethtaylorsolicitors.co.uk".

The website "www.garethtaylorsolicitors.co.uk" is operating, falsely claiming to be for a law firm.

The website provides the same telephone number, postal address and email address noted above. The website misuses the names of a number of genuine solicitors, most of whom are employed at one genuine firm (see below). The website also misuses the image of a genuine solicitor and the SRA ID for another genuine solicitor.

Any business or transactions through "Gareth Taylor Solicitors", including through the website and contact details set out above, are not carried out by a solicitors practice or an individual authorised or regulated by the SRA.
